The project will last for 25 months (December 2022 to December 2024) and, upon completion, the following outputs will have been created and translated into all partner languages:
- 10 learning modules divided into three different phases.
- 3 lesson plans for each learning module. This will result in a total of 30 lesson plans.
- The development of a Moodle-like platform for the project content and for teachers and learners.

Coding4Kids is an innovative educational project funded by the Erasmus+ programme that advocates training children in the programming language, as digital skills are becoming more and more important in our society and it is essential that children start learning them.
